FITZPATRICK HOMERS THREE TIMES DURING WEEKEND SWEEP FOR HAWKS OVER COUGARS
FARLEY, Iowa – The Northeast Community College baseball team headed to Farley, Iowa Saturday and Sunday for their first-ever showdowns against Northeast Iowa Community College, a new team added to the ICCAC this season. The Hawks swept the series by final scores of 6-1, 17-6 and 17-3.

Northeast (20-13, 3-1 ICCAC) gave the ball to Caden Rezac (Ogallala, Neb.) and the sophomore tossed seven innings and allowed just three hits on the mound while striking out five batters. Brady Fitzpatrick (Bellevue, Neb.) launched two homers and recorded a double in the matchup to propel the Hawks to victory.
In Game 2 Saturday, the Northeast offense exploded for 17 runs as Hayden Parrish (Omaha, Neb.) and Kye Privett (Papillion, Neb.) both sent balls over the fence. Fitzpatrick added three more RBIs and Giuseppe Salvatore (Johnstown, Colo.) totaled three RBIs of his own to continue the tear he has been on to start the season. Barrett Fries picked up the victory on the mound, recording seven strikeouts in 4.2 innings of work.
On Sunday, the Hawks were able to throw up 17 runs again behind nine runs in the seventh inning. Aaron Artsen (Staten Island, N.Y.), Alex Martin (Loveland, Colo.), Fitzpatrick, and Lou Hodoly (Omaha, Neb.) all homered in the ballgame while the Northeast pitching staff consisting of Beckett Lund (Lincoln, Neb.), Cole Kuszak (Broomfield, Colo.), Ethan Cole (Omaha, Neb.), Thomas Marshall (Mississauga, Ontario) and Beau Pasteur (Pittsburg, Kan.) combined to strikeout 22 different batters throughout the afternoon.

HEAR FROM THE HAWKS COACH:
Head Baseball Coach Marcus Clapp on Northeast's two victories on Saturday:
"I thought Caden Rezac threw well and kept them pretty quiet all game," Clapp said. "We didn't really get going offensively until the fifth inning, but Brady Fitzpatrick had a big day at the plate and got us going. Good to see him have a day!"
Clapp on what worked for his group in Sunday's victory:
"We pitched really well," Clapp said. "Punching out 22 in a game is the most ever. Beckett Lund was much better today, and the pen did their job. Offensively, it took us a little to get going, but we found a way. We have to make quicker adjustments at the plate."
